Security Patching and Vulnerability Management: A Comprehensive Guide
Vulnerability management is a proactive approach to cybersecurity that involves continuous monitoring and remediation of security flaws. It encompasses a range of activities, from vulnerability scanning and risk assessment to patch management and incident response. The goal is to minimize the attack surface and prevent potential exploits that could compromise sensitive data or disrupt operations.
Security patching is a fundamental aspect of vulnerability management. Patches are updates released by software vendors to fix known vulnerabilities.

The Vulnerability Management Lifecycle
The vulnerability management lifecycle consists of several stages, each playing a crucial role in maintaining security. These stages include:
- Discovery: Identifying assets and vulnerabilities within the network.
- Prioritization: Assessing the severity of vulnerabilities based on factors like exploitability and potential impact.
- Remediation: Applying patches or other mitigations to address vulnerabilities.
- Verification: Confirming that remediation efforts were successful.
- Reporting: Documenting findings and actions for compliance and continuous improvement.
Key Challenges in Vulnerability Management
Organizations often face challenges in implementing effective vulnerability management programs. Some common issues include:
- Resource constraints: Limited staff and budget can hinder comprehensive vulnerability scanning and patching.
- Complexity: Large and diverse IT environments make it difficult to track and manage all vulnerabilities.
- Patch compatibility: Some patches may cause compatibility issues with existing systems, requiring thorough testing before deployment.
- Zero-day vulnerabilities: These are unknown flaws that attackers exploit before a patch is available, necessitating alternative mitigation strategies.
Comparison of Leading Vulnerability Management Tools
Tool | Key Features | Pricing |
---|---|---|
Tenable Nessus | Comprehensive vulnerability scanning, real-time assessments, detailed reporting | Starting at $3,390 per year |
Qualys Vulnerability Management | Cloud-based, continuous monitoring, automated patching | Custom pricing based on assets |
Rapid7 InsightVM | Risk-based prioritization, integration with SIEM tools, customizable dashboards | Starting at $2,500 per year |
OpenVAS | Open-source, community-supported, extensive vulnerability database | Free |
Best Practices for Effective Vulnerability Management
To maximize the effectiveness of vulnerability management, organizations should adopt the following best practices:
- Regular scanning: Conduct frequent vulnerability scans to identify new threats.
- Automated patching: Use tools to automate the patch deployment process, reducing manual effort and errors.
- Risk-based prioritization: Focus on vulnerabilities that pose the highest risk to critical assets.
- Employee training: Educate staff on cybersecurity best practices to reduce human error.
- Incident response planning: Prepare for potential breaches with a well-defined response strategy.
By following these guidelines, organizations can enhance their security posture and stay ahead of emerging threats. For further reading, consider visiting the official websites of Tenable , Qualys , and Rapid7 .